>We received a large photographic slide collection of mostly cacti
>(ca. 15,000), accompanied by the donor's 3 1/2 inch PC-formatted
>floppy disks of what are reported to be the inventory/catalogues of
>these slides. Whether the source was from a PC or a Mac isn't
>certain. Most of the files are small, ca. 38 KB.
>
>We have tried, some talented students have tried, but no luck
>finding a way to use them.
>
>The files have the following types of names (and date to 1992 and
1993):
>cact-n-a.gen
>cact-n-a.num
>cact-n-a.qua
>
>and others that appear to be related:
>coryph.num
>coryph.qua
>coryph.spe
>
>and other apparent groupings:
>opuntia.bes
>opuntia.num
>opuntia.spe
>
>agavemex.nam
>agavemex.num
>agavemex.qua
>
>There are also some files that end with ".bdb", ".nam", ".bst",
>".tot", ".ncf", ".wor"
>Some configuration files are labeled "macros" or "works"
>
>Suggestions for how to proceed would be most welcome.
